About us
Avencia is your talent outsourcing partner. We bring a fresh perspective to recruitment outsourcing, favouring simplicity over complexity, quality over volume, and personalisation over uniformity.
Backed by an undisputed track record in insurance and other growing industries, we partner with HR and Talent Acquisition to provide flexible and bespoke strategic services which are critical to our client’s business.
We partner with our clients to understand their Talent Acquisition challenges and design solutions tailored to their needs.
The role
Due to continued growth on one of our key accounts, we are seeking a Talent Sourcing Partner to join our on-site team working on a hybrid basis – The client is based in Central London and we anticipate that the role will likely require 2/3 days a week on site. This is a Permanent opportunity, where you will join a well-established, well-embedded Client Services team. Our client is unique in their approach to Insurance, is rapidly expanding year-on-year and, as such, this is not your every day, run-of-the mill candidate sourcing role!
The position itself will involve you identifying, engaging with, and placing candidates across multiple disciplines. You will also support our existing team of Recruitment Business Partners with short term projects, talent pooling, candidate management, candidate feedback, market mapping and other recruitment focused tasks.
This role is ideal for a recent graduate seeking their first opportunity in Talent Acquisition, or for a Coordinator/Administrator with up to 12 months of experience looking to step into a more sourcing-focused position with a clear path for career growth.
